How much does the average commute cost workers in Mellette County, South Dakota?
Commuters here spend an estimated 109 hours a year on the road, worth roughly $3,379 at a typical national wage. That's 15% less than the typical South Dakota commuter spends.
When is rush hour worst in Mellette County, South Dakota?
Traffic peaks between 07:00 AM – 07:29 AM in Mellette County, South Dakota. Leaving before or after this window is the single easiest way to avoid the heaviest local congestion, though 07:30 AM – 07:59 AM also sees a secondary bump.
Is public transportation a realistic commute option in Mellette County, South Dakota?
Public transit usage is significantly lower here than typical: about 0.0% of commuters use it versus 0.5% in South Dakota, meaning a personal vehicle is essential for most workers.
Where are the quickest and slowest commutes among counties in South Dakota?
Among counties in South Dakota, the shortest average commutes are in Jones County (6.4 min), Jackson County (7.5 min), Bennett County (7.7 min). The longest are in McCook County (26.4 min), Ziebach County (25.1 min), Turner County (25.1 min).
